Surveillance and Upkeep Tips
Given the critical function that proper ventilation plays in protecting against mold and mildew growth, it is essential to establish effective surveillance and upkeep suggestions to ensure the continued performance of ventilation systems. Normal evaluations of ventilation systems need to be conducted to inspect for any indicators of clogs, leakages, or malfunctions that might restrain appropriate air movement. Surveillance humidity degrees within the residential or commercial property is also vital, as high moisture can add to mold and mildew growth. Setting up a hygrometer can assist track moisture levels and sharp house owners to any spikes that might need focus. In addition, ensuring that air filters are consistently cleaned up or changed is necessary for maintaining the performance of the ventilation system. Implementing a routine for regular maintenance tasks, such as duct cleaning and cooling and heating system evaluations, can help protect against problems prior to they escalate. By remaining mindful and aggressive to the problem of air flow systems, residential or commercial property owners can properly minimize the danger of mold and mildew regrowth and maintain a healthy indoor setting.
